I heard so many stories about the bride's feet hurting the day of the wedding because of their shoes, and I really want to be comfortable. I'm just not sure how it would look wearing flats. I'm also having my fitting done soon and I have to bring my shoes with me.

If you were flats for on your weeding, can you attach a pic below?

    I don't have a pic yet (still choosing shoes!) but I'm definitely wearing flats. I'm 5'9", FH is 5'10"... if I wore heels, I'd be towering over him AND my feet would hurt. No thank you! Also, my father is very short (5'4"!) so I really don't need any extra height to complicate the father daughter dance.

    One of my friends suggested that I could get heels to wear for the rehearsal dinner and some of the pictures on my wedding day, but I definitely don't care enough to worry about whether or not I'm in heels in any of my pictures!

    I wore flats. My husband is not that tall so I didn't want to be taller than him and I'm glad I did. The flats I got were $15 at Charlotte Russe, lace flats and so comfortable! I bought heels for pictures but flats the rest of the night. Comfort is everything! Plus they couldn't see my shoes under my long dress.
